PHILADELPHIA (WPVI) -- City leaders made their case Wednesday for the removal of the Christopher Columbus statue in South Philadelphia. The city cited public safety concerns and feedback from the ...
Every time I walk by the statue of Christopher Columbus a few blocks south of my Philadelphia office, I get flashbacks about the hot, June days at the beginning of the pandemic in 2020, days after ...
TRENTON, New Jersey (WPVI) -- Christopher Columbus statues have been taken down in two New Jersey cities. The statue Christopher Columbus is no longer standing in the city of Trenton amid criticism 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results